What Is a Gravity Filling Machine?

A gravity filling machine is a basic yet highly reliable volumetric filling device that operates purely under atmospheric pressure. Unlike pressure-driven, vacuum-assisted, or mechanically metered filling equipment, it utilizes the natural gravity flow of liquids to complete container filling without external extrusion, suction, or complex sensor calibration.
Equipped with precision flow control valves and timed filling modules, gravity fillers regulate liquid output volume by controlling filling time and flow rate. The entire filling process depends on stable liquid level height and gravity potential energy, ensuring steady and consistent volumetric dosing. Designed exclusively for low-viscosity, non-foamy, still liquids with stable physical properties, this machine features a streamlined structure, fewer vulnerable parts, and easy operation. It is widely adopted in medium and small-scale production lines for bottled water, fruit wine, edible oil, and daily chemical liquids, delivering stable batch quality with minimal operational costs.

Core Working Principle & Step-by-Step Filling Process

Gravity filling works on fluid mechanics and atmospheric pressure balance theory. It realizes standardized volumetric filling through fully gravity-driven flow and intelligent timing control, with no mechanical force applied to materials.
Container Positioning & Sealing: Empty bottles or containers are accurately positioned under filling nozzles. The nozzle contact structure seals the bottle mouth gently to prevent liquid splashing and external air interference during gravity flow.
Constant Liquid Level Stabilization: The material tank maintains a fixed liquid level height at all times, ensuring stable gravity pressure and consistent liquid flow rate throughout the production process, eliminating flow fluctuation errors.
Gravity-Driven Liquid Flow: After nozzle opening, liquids flow naturally from the high-level material tank into low-positioned containers under atmospheric pressure and self-weight, achieving smooth and steady filling.
Timed Volumetric Control: The PLC system precisely controls the opening duration of the filling valve. With a fixed flow rate, accurate filling volume is achieved through standardized timing parameters for each container specification.
Automatic Valve Closing & Anti-Drip: Once the preset filling time ends, the filling valve closes instantly. The built-in anti-drip nozzle structure prevents residual liquid dripping, keeping containers and production lines clean.
Continuous Cyclic Production: After one filling cycle is completed, the equipment resets automatically to start the next round of positioning and filling, supporting uninterrupted assembly line mass production.

Key Advantages of Gravity Filling Machines

Compared with high-precision complex fillers and manual filling methods, gravity filling machines stand out with unbeatable cost performance, operational stability, and low maintenance requirements for conventional still liquid production.
Ultra-Low Equipment & Operational Cost: Simple mechanical structure eliminates expensive servo motors, precision sensors, and complex vacuum systems. It greatly reduces initial procurement costs and daily energy consumption, ideal for cost-sensitive mass production.
Extremely High Operational Stability: With fewer electronic and mechanical vulnerable parts, gravity fillers avoid frequent failures caused by sensor drift, motor wear, and pipeline blockage. Long-term continuous operation maintains stable batch filling quality.
Simple Operation & Low Labor Dependency: Intuitive timing and flow parameter setting requires no professional technical training. Ordinary workers can complete equipment operation, parameter adjustment, and daily debugging efficiently.
Smooth Material Protection: Pure gravity natural flow avoids mechanical extrusion, high-pressure impact, and bubble generation. It protects the original texture, flavor, and purity of fragile still liquids without ingredient damage.
Easy Cleaning & Maintenance: Open and streamlined material pipelines have no dead corners for residue accumulation. Daily cleaning and routine maintenance are simple and efficient, reducing manual maintenance workload.
Wide Compatibility with Standard Containers: Adaptable to various common bottle specifications such as PET bottles, glass bottles, and plastic cans. Fast parameter switching meets multi-specification flexible production demands.
